PARROT FLYPAD:
CHARGING THE BATTERY
1. Connect the micro USB cable to the Parrot
Flypad’s micro USB port.
2. Connect the USB port to a computer or a USB
power adapter.
> The charge LED turns red to indicate that
charging is in progress. Once charging is
complete, the LED turns green.
TAKE OFF
8
The charge time is approximately 2 hours. Once
charged, the Parrot Flypad has a battery life of
about 6 hours.

PARROT SWING
The Parrot Swing is not suitable for children under 14 years of age.
The Parrot Swing is a model aircraft designed for recreation and leisure. The pi-
lot must, at all times, maintain eye contact with the Parrot Swing and control its
trajectory. The Parrot Swing must be used according to the rules of civil aviation
in your country. The places where it is used must be suitable for its progres-
sion in order to continuously ensure the safety of people, animals and property.
Using the Parrot Swing in some public places (for example: train stations, airpo-
rts, etc.) or on public roads may not be allowed.
The Parrot Swing’s propellers in flight can cause damage to people, animals or
objects. Always stay a safe distance away from the
Parrot Swing. Do not touch the Parrot Swing in flight. Wait for the propellers to
fully stop before handling the Parrot Swing.
Only use accessories specified by Parrot Drones SAS.
If sand or dust gets into the Parrot Swing, it may be irreparably damaged and
no longer function properly.
Do not use the Parrot Swing in adverse weather conditions (rain, strong wind or
snow) or when visibility is poor (at night).
Keep the Parrot Swing away from high voltage power lines, buildings or any
other potentially hazardous areas.
Do not use this device near liquids. Do not place the Parrot Swing on water or
on a wet surface as this could cause irreparable damage.
Do not leave the Parrot Swing in the sun.
WARNING REGARDING PRIVACY AND RESPECT FOR IMAGES
OF PROPERTY
Recording and broadcasting an individual’s image without their permission may
constitute an invasion of privacy and you may be held liable. Ask permission
before filming people, especially if you intend to keep your recordings and/
or broadcast them. Do not broadcast degrading images which may affect an
individual’s reputation or dignity.
Recording and broadcasting the image of property without permission from
its owner and or any third party holding intellectual property rights on the pro-
18
perty may constitute a violation of the property’s image rights and you may be
held liable. Ask permission from its owner and/or any third party with ownership
rights.

BATTERY
WARNING: Failure to follow all the instructions may result in serious injury, ir-
reparable damage to the battery and may cause a fire, smoke or explosion.
Always check the battery’s condition before charging or using it. Replace the bat-
tery if it has been dropped, or in case of odour, overheating, discolouration, de-
formation or leakage. Never use anything other than the approved LiPo charger
to charge the battery. Always use a balancing charger for LiPo cells or a LiPo cell
balancer. It is recommended that you do not to use any other charger than the one
20
provided with the product. Never trickle charge or charge under 2.5 V per cell. The
battery temperature must never exceed 60 °C (140 °F) otherwise the battery could
be damaged or ignite. Never charge on a flammable surface, near flammable
products or inside a vehicle (preferably place the battery in a non-flammable and
non-conductive container). Never leave the battery unattended during the char-
ging process. Never disassemble or modify the housing’s wiring, or puncture the
cells. Always ensure that the charger output voltage corresponds to the voltage
of the battery. Do not short circuit the batteries. Never expose the LiPo battery to
moisture or direct sunlight, or store it in a place where temperatures could exceed
60 °C (car in the sun, for example). Always keep it out of reach of children. Improper
battery use may result in a fire, explosion or other hazard.
The battery terminals should not be allowed to short-circuit. The product
should be connected only to class II appliances which display the symbol.
